Charging Instructions

The product uses a built-in 1500mAh lithium battery. Charging can be done with a TYPE-C compatible charger. The maximum charging voltage and current are limited to 5V/2A. Power banks can also be used for charging.

Automatic Shutdown Instructions

The device will automatically shut down after 3 minutes of inactivity in the APP or if the WiFi connection is disconnected. It does not shut down automatically during recording.

Installation Steps

Follow these steps to install the camera:

  1. Step 1: Hold the external positioning ring to fix its position. Turn the fastening rotating ring counterclockwise to move the fastening buckle to its maximum position. (Refer to Figure 1)
  2. Step 2: Aim the product lens at the eyepiece of the optical telescope or microscope. (Refer to Figure 2)
  3. Step 3: Hold the external positioning ring to fix its position. Turn the fastening rotating ring clockwise to secure the electronic eyepiece without obvious loosening. Ensure the product sleeve is horizontal and tight against the eyepiece; misalignment can affect image quality. (Refer to Figure 3)
  4. Step 4: Adjust the lens orientation by turning the lens orientation adjustment ring, ensuring the punctuation mark points upwards. (Refer to Figure 4)
  5. Step 5: Install the silicone ring. For installation, ensure the thicker side of the silicone ring wall faces inward (towards the lens). Align the fastening buckle and press down until it clicks into place. (Refer to Figure 5) Note: A silicone ring is required if the eyepiece diameter is 30mm or less.
  6. Step 6: For first-time use, format the TF memory card via the APP settings.

APP Connection Instructions

Follow these steps to connect the camera to your device via the Lercenker app:

  1. Open the "Lercenker" app and tap "Camera".
  2. Tap "Retry" if necessary. Ensure the product has sufficient power and necessary permissions are granted.
  3. In the network list, select the WiFi name "EP01_XXXXXXX" (default password: 12345678). Tip: You can set up the WiFi connection before starting the app if the camera's blue light is flashing rapidly.
  4. After successful connection, return to the app interface.
  5. The app defaults to "Video" mode. Tap "Photo" to switch modes.

Time Lapse Settings:

Note: After activating the time-lapse function, the device must be turned off before the task begins. The function stops if manually turned on. When the app is connected, the device automatically synchronizes the correct time. Changing WiFi name or password requires re-establishing the connection.
